This book addresses the issue of anxiety in a light-hearted and reassuring manner.

Charlie is an anxious dachshund who worries that something terrible might happen if he doesn't keep to his daily rituals. After he is called upon to help rescue a friend and in the rush forgets his rituals, Charlie discovers that he doesn't have to be ruled by them and that change can have really positive outcomes.

Charlie's character was inspired by Terry's daughter, who went through a phase of daily rituals to help combat anxiety. Terry became aware that it is a behaviour pattern which is common amongst children and indeed adults. This book addresses the issue in a light-hearted and reassuring way. Whether or not you are anxious, the story of Charlie is bound to capture your heart!

Terry Milne

Terry Milne was born in South Africa but is now based in Oxford, England. She has illustrated books with authors such as Martin Waddell, Angela McAllister and Vivian French, working with UK publishers such as Andersen Press and Walker Books.

Her daughter's struggles with anxiety and repetitive behaviour led Terry to write and illustrate the story of Charlie Star, as a reassurance to children everywhere who have the same struggles.
